    Review

    Progressive Home Health Care in Wichita is best suited for families seeking deeply personal, relationship-driven in-home health support. The program shines when caregivers establish ongoing, long-term contact with a patient - nurses and therapists who remember routines, preferences, and warning signs, and who advocate for the patient with doctors and pharmacies. For seniors facing chronic conditions, post-acute recovery, or wounds that require careful monitoring, the continuity and empathy of staff can translate into steadier days and better adherence to treatment plans. The service also benefits clients dealing with dementia or fluctuating mood, where patient-centered communication helps reduce confusion and anxiety. That depth of relationship is a strength, but it comes with a caveat: reliability and rapid escalation are not uniformly guaranteed, and that matters for certain care needs.

    On the plus side, the care teams are repeatedly praised for compassion, competence, and accessible communication. Families describe nurses who stay with patients for years or multiple visits, building trust and comfort. Clinicians like Alicia, Jetta, Gayle, and Kristi are cited for going beyond the basics - coordinating meds, reinforcing wound care, and speaking with primary care doctors when concerns arise. The ability to handle wound healing, chronic disease management, and medication organization is frequently highlighted, with aides and therapists who coordinate transmission of information to families and to medical teams. Even in challenging days, patients report feeling supported, engaged, and uplifted by staff who combine professionalism with genuine care.

    Still, the agency does carry notable consistency risks. A segment of reviews points to scheduling gaps, late arrivals, or missed visits that leave families waiting and uncertain. There are explicit complaints about unreturned calls, a lack of timely updates, and at least one high-profile instance of a supervisor who delivered poor service and failed to address concerns. Some promises - such as broader, more frequent assistance than showers, or guaranteed two hours per week - did not materialize in certain cases, revealing gaps between expectations and reality. These lapses undermine trust and can disrupt recovery or daily routines, especially for patients who rely on precise timetables and clear escalation paths.

    Yet, the strongest pros tend to offset these cons for most clients, when the care plan is actively managed. The same staff who demonstrate warmth often deliver measurable improvements in daily function, wound healing, and adherence to medications, thanks to consistent caregivers who know the patient's history. Families emphasize the comfort of a dedicated nurse who communicates with the physician, arranges medications, and coordinates with therapists. The staff's patient, practical approach - firm yet compassionate - helps patients stay on track even as mood or confusion shifts. The existence of long-tenured clinicians also means less repetition for families and more accurate updates, reducing the burden on relatives who must navigate complex care needs.

    For those whose top priority is strict, predictable scheduling and proactive escalation from a capable supervisor, alternatives may be worth exploring. The unfortunate incidents of missed visits and a difficult supervisory interaction signal that some cases face systemic gaps in accountability. Patients or families who cannot tolerate late starts, unreturned messages, or uncertain who is in charge may prefer another provider with tighter service-level guarantees and a clear chain of command. In situations requiring intensive, time-defined support - such as immediate post-operative rehab with guaranteed daily visits - the risk of inconsistent execution could outweigh the benefits of strong bedside care by other staff.

    Before committing, articulate a plan around named caregivers, expected visit counts, and escalation steps. Seek a guaranteed point of contact in the office and ask for a trial period to assess scheduling reliability, communication, and responsiveness. Confirm the care team's experience with wound care, post-acute rehab, dementia care, and medication management, and request examples of successful coordination with PCPs and specialists. Query whether hospice services are integrated when appropriate, and verify the agency's policy on replacement staff during vacations or illness to maintain continuity. For families valuing compassionate, dedicated caregivers who build trust over time, Progressive Home Health Care offers a compelling match; for others requiring flawless reliability and tight operational control, exploring alternatives is prudent.

    • skilled nursing facility vs nursing homeSkilled Nursing Facilities vs. Nursing Homes: Making Sense of the Differences

      Skilled nursing facilities (SNFs) provide high-level medical care and rehabilitation for short-term recovery, typically covered by Medicare after hospitalization, while nursing homes focus on ongoing custodial care for chronic conditions, mainly funded by Medicaid or private payments. The staffing and regulatory structures differ significantly between the two, necessitating clarity for families in choosing appropriate long-term care options.

    • non medical home careExploring Nonmedical Home Care: Understanding Services, Costs, and Financial Approaches

      Nonmedical home care provides assistance with daily activities and companionship for individuals wishing to maintain independence and quality of life at home, without medical intervention. Its growing popularity is driven by an aging population, the need for supportive environments for recovery, and the emotional benefits of caregiver companionship, while costs vary based on service frequency and location.
